The intermittent unseasonal rain that lashed across the district has damaged the rabi crops, and also house roofs in many villages have been thrown off by heavy wind.
           
The untimely rain was experienced in many places including the city during the last three days, local residents said.
           
The wind and rain have damaged the standing crops- wheat, gram, mango, orange, vegetables. Many house roofs have also been thrown off in many places which rendered many poor villagers roofless, the locals said.
           
In the adjoining Lohara village, a neem tree fell on the electric line that snapped the supply for over 3-4 hours.
           
There were thunder and lightning also but no casuality reported from any where in the district. In Digras, there was hailstorm also which damaged the crops to a great extent.
           
Darwha, Mahagaon, Ner, Ghatanji, Babhulgaon and the adjoining villages have also received medium rainfall. The district has received an average of 1.93 mm rain during the last couple of days, weather bureau official said.
           
The farmers brought their grains to the APMC have also suffered heavy loss due to the untimely rain as there was no arrangement to protect them from getting wet.
